4. Penalty Kick Challenge Station
Every soccer party needs some actual soccer action, and a penalty kick station delivers the excitement! Set up a portable goal in your backyard or use a large cardboard box with holes cut out for targets. Assign point values to different sections of the goal, making corner shots worth more than center kicks. Keep score on a visible leaderboard to fuel that competitive spirit and award small prizes for high scorers. You can adjust difficulty based on age groups by changing the kicking distance or goal size. Add obstacles or require trick shots for older kids who want an extra challenge. This activity keeps guests engaged while others are eating or doing quieter activities, ensuring there's never a dull moment at your party!

6. World Cup Tournament Setup
Organize a mini World Cup tournament that'll have everyone feeling like professional players! Divide guests into small teams, letting them choose country names and create simple team chants. Set up a bracket system on a large poster board where everyone can track match progress throughout the party. Keep games short, around five to seven minutes each, to maintain energy and include everyone. Use pinnies or bandanas to distinguish teams and appoint rotating referees from party guests or adults. Award points not just for goals but also for sportsmanship and team spirit. The tournament structure gives your party a natural flow and builds excitement toward the final match. Crown the winning team with medals or trophies during your closing ceremony for that authentic championship feeling!

9. Soccer Skills Competition Games
Test your guests' soccer abilities with a series of skill challenges that go beyond basic kicking! Set up stations for juggling contests, where players see who can keep the ball airborne longest using feet, knees, and heads. Create a accuracy challenge using hula hoops suspended at different heights as targets. Include a speed dribbling course where players navigate through cones as quickly as possible without losing control. Add a long-distance kick competition measuring who can boot the ball the farthest. Keep things inclusive by having different categories based on age or skill level so everyone has a chance to shine. Post results on a leaderboard and award silly titles like "Fastest Feet" or "Most Accurate Striker" to multiple winners.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: What age group works best for a soccer-themed birthday party?
A: Soccer parties work great for ages 4 through 14, with activities adjusted accordingly.
Q2: How much space do I need for soccer party activities?
A: A backyard or local park with 30x20 feet minimum works perfectly well.
Q3: What if some guests don't like or play soccer?
A: Include creative activities like jersey decorating and photo booths for non-athletes.
Q4: How long should a soccer birthday party last?
A: Two to three hours provides enough time without exhausting young players.
Q5: Can I host a soccer party indoors?
A: Yes! Use foam balls and modify activities for indoor spaces and gymnasiums.
